Latest Patents

Daisuke Ohno's most recent patents include novel applications in acid matrix systems. One notable invention involves well stimulation and completion fluids that utilize viscoelastic surfactants combined with modified additives. This composition enhances oil and gas well formations by utilizing a viscoelastic surfactant alongside a modified nanomaterial, which may incorporate features such as nanocellulose and diverse functional groups including sulfate and amino groups.

Another significant patent pertains to an asymmetric membrane made from a crosslinked polyimide resin. This membrane is characterized by structural units derived from tetracarboxylic dianhydride and diamine, allowing for tailored applications in selective permeability and filtration processes.
